Ulmo Meaning and Origin

Ulmo is a German-rooted masculine name best known from J.R.R. Tolkien's legendarium, where Ulmo is the lord of waters and one of the most powerful Valar. The name itself is believed to derive from a Germanic root related to the elm tree, a symbol of strength and endurance. Its mythic and natural associations give it a deep, resonant quality.

  • Germanic root: connected to the elm tree, symbolizing strength and resilience
  • Famous bearer: Ulmo, the lord of all waters in Tolkien's mythology
  • Two syllables, "UL-mo," with a firm, grounded sound
  • Masculine name with a strong, ancient feel
